Employment law & rota compliance for hospitality

Working Time, Employment Rights Act and zero‑hours

Employment law is shifting fast for UK hospitality, from Working Time rules to the Employment Rights Act and zero‑hours reforms. Use the resources below to understand what’s changing, stresstest your rotas and contracts, and see how the Hospitality People Suite can help you stay compliant while keeping every site reliably staffed. 

  • Working Time Regulations and rota compliance basics.
  • Employment Rights Act 2025: timelines and what changes for hospitality.
  • Zero‑hours and low‑hours contracts – fair termination and transition to guaranteed hours.
  • How the Hospitality People Suite, including Rotaready Evo and CPL Learning Evo, supports forecasting, patterns, audit trails and compliance.
